Introduction to B2B Wholesale Exports

In today’s interconnected world, businesses are increasingly seeking to tap into global markets through wholesale exports. B2B (business-to-business) wholesale exports allow manufacturers and suppliers to extend their reach beyond domestic borders, opening the door to new opportunities and revenue streams. Understanding the Importance of Exporting

Exporting helps companies diversify their customer base, protect against domestic market fluctuations, and gain competitive advantages. For B2B wholesalers, exporting can lead to increased brand recognition and a sustainable business model. Understanding the export landscape is crucial for anyone looking to become a successful player in this field.

Identifying Target Markets

The first step in formulating a successful export strategy is identifying the right target markets. Researching potential countries and understanding their market dynamics can provide valuable information. Consider factors such as economic stability, consumer preferences, and regulatory requirements. Tools like SWOT analysis can help you evaluate your position against the competition in each target market.

Building Strong Supplier Relationships

As you embark on your exporting journey, forming strong relationships with suppliers is essential. Establishing trust and clear communication with your suppliers can enhance the quality and reliability of your products. By working closely with suppliers, you can ensure that you maintain consistent quality, adhere to compliance regulations, and meet demand in international markets.

Effective Marketing Techniques for Exporting

Marketing is a strategic pillar that supports successful exporting. Employing effective marketing techniques can significantly impact your reach and growth in global markets. Here are some strategies:

Utilizing Digital Marketing

In a digital age, leveraging online platforms is crucial for B2B wholesalers looking to export. Utilize SEO (Search Engine Optimization), social media, and email marketing to showcase your products and capabilities. Create engaging content that targets specific audiences in your chosen markets. Remember, having a well-optimized website is essential to enhancing your online presence.

Trade Shows and Expos

Participating in international trade shows and expos allows businesses to connect directly with potential buyers and partners. These events provide opportunities to showcase your products, network with industry leaders, and gain market insights. Be sure to prepare thoroughly for these events to maximize your exposure.

Navigating Regulatory Requirements

Entering international markets often involves navigating various regulatory frameworks. Familiarize yourself with trade laws, tariffs, and import/export regulations of your target countries. Engaging with export consultants or legal experts can help you avoid costly mistakes and ensure compliance with international trade agreements.

Logistics and Supply Chain Management

A robust logistics strategy is vital for successful exporting. Efficient supply chain management ensures timely delivery and customer satisfaction. Explore options for shipping, customs clearance, and freight forwarding, and choose the best solutions that align with your business goals. Investing in technology can streamline operations and improve transparency.

Monitoring and Adapting Your Strategy

Finally, successful exporting requires continuous monitoring and adaptation of your strategies. Regularly assess market performance, gather feedback from customers, and stay informed about global trends. Be prepared to adapt your strategies to meet evolving consumer demands and competitive pressures.
